FREQUENT SEATTLE HVAC PROBLEMS
Living in the Pacific Northwest means your system works through constant moisture, cool temperatures, and older home layouts—conditions that often lead to recurring HVAC problems in Seattle. Homeowners across Ballard, Fremont, West Seattle, and beyond commonly experience these issues:
-
Uneven heating: Older Seattle homes with drafty windows or outdated ductwork often develop stubborn cold spots.
-
Heat pumps and furnaces that struggle in damp weather: Moisture and chilly air make systems work harder to keep rooms comfortable.
-
Indoor air quality concerns: Moisture, pollen, and year-round allergens can accumulate indoors, especially in tightly sealed homes.
-
Noisy or aging equipment: Older systems in Seattle-area houses may rattle, squeal, or short-cycle as components wear out.
-
High energy bills: Constantly running systems, clogged filters, or aging parts can drive up utility costs across Seattle neighborhoods.
-
Frequent cycling: Systems may turn on and off repeatedly due to thermostat issues, airflow restrictions, or damp outdoor conditions.
-
Poor cooling performance: During warmer summer weeks, some air conditioners or heat pumps struggle to remove humidity and maintain comfort.

HOW SEATTLE’S CLIMATE MAKES THESE ISSUES WORSE
Seattle’s weather creates the perfect conditions for HVAC trouble. The constant drizzle, salty Sound air, and long stretches of damp cold all make HVAC in Seattle work harder than systems in drier climates.
Year-round moisture can clog filters quickly, put extra strain on heat pumps, and cause parts to wear sooner. Mild summers also mean your system rarely runs long enough to remove humidity from the house, leading to stagnant air. Once winter hits, that chilly, wet air forces furnaces and heat pumps to fight harder to keep older homes comfortable.

WHEN TO CALL A LOCAL SEATTLE HVAC PRO
Some issues are more than everyday quirks—they’re signs your system needs professional attention. Because HVAC systems in Seattle operate in frequent dampness and shifting temperatures, problems can escalate faster than homeowners expect. Here are situations where Seattle residents should bring in a pro:
-
Heat pump struggling on damp days: If your system falls behind whenever the weather turns misty, it may be losing efficiency.
-
Furnace running nonstop: Continuous operation during Seattle’s cold, wet winters often signals deeper performance problems.
-
Air that feels clammy or heavy: When indoor air never seems to dry out, your system may not be removing moisture effectively.
-
Persistent odors: Musty or earthy smells often point to moisture buildup inside the system.
-
Older equipment showing new issues: Aging systems common in Seattle homes can fail quickly once symptoms begin.
